Output dd12903a1300bafb48ea585c78d275a85a1ac89e6127373f40c8918a8d9ab893:1

value
14903344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 917bb38c8666807f2aa0ff18edec1864af5473e1 OP_EQUAL
address
3ExG6HE1EZBYWimZH5e2GL9vzjUTitQ1d1
transaction
dd12903a1300bafb48ea585c78d275a85a1ac89e6127373f40c8918a8d9ab893
spent
true